Menudo was formed in 1977 by Edgardo Díaz. The original line up consisted of 5 members, the Sallaberry brothers, Fernando and Nefty, and Díaz’s cousins, the Melendez brothers, Oscar, Carlos, and Ricky.

What is Menudo called in English?
In Mexican cuisine, Menudo, also known as pancita ([little] gut or [little] stomach) or mole de panza (“stomach sauce”), is a traditional Mexican soup, made with cow’s stomach (tripe) in broth with a red chili pepper base.

Who owns the name Menudo?
The South Florida-based Menudo International, LLC acquired the Menudo trademark in May 2016 with plans to relaunch the franchise, which spans back to 1977 and was a starting point for Ricky Martin and Robi “Draco” Rosa in the mid-1980s.

Is Menudo Mexican or Filipino?
Menudo, also known as ginamay or ginagmay (Cebuano: “[chopped into] smaller pieces”), is a traditional stew from the Philippines made with pork and sliced liver in tomato sauce with carrots and potatoes. Unlike the Mexican dish of the same name, it does not use tripe or red chili sauce.
Why is Menudo called Menudo?
From Spanish menudo, from Latin minūtus (“small, little”). Doublet of minuto and menu.
